  6. Hong Kong - Girls are being rented out for $36 a day in China to bachelors who cannot face going home to their mothers without a girlfriend, a news report said on Wednesday. Marriage agencies in Liuzhou in southern China's Guangxi province are renting out the girlfriends to migrant workers returning home to their families for the Chinese New Year holiday in February. They are doing a brisk business from men who cannot face being pestered by their mothers back home for not having a girlfriend, the Hong Kong edition of the China Daily reported. Women charge an average of $36 a day but the practice has been criticised by some people as a violation of Chinese traditions and morals, the newspaper said.
